numbers 12 were the most faithful of the story balloon. Massimo
Pylons was (but thank God still is), a big man from the massive physique, from Ancona to arrive at the Juventus youth.
were still times of the satellite companies and faithful to Madame. Ancona, Forlì, Cremonese and Atalanta. Who landed at Juve he often did that path, a mixture of experience and words of honor ties between the presidents of those teams and Giampiero Boniperti. Business was always good for both.
After a year in Caserta, Max returned to Turin where he remained for six years. He found that robbed Tancredi's place holder because of a broken hand and was always to do the second before Carmignani and then the national Dinon.
Among the bad memories of the first leg of the Fairs Cup final against Leeds, a draw at home 2 to 2 but with responsibility for a goal of the British.
Among the fond memories, two paratone exceptional season in 71-72, which avoids the pratfall to Juve in Mantua and then allowed the Bianconeri to win the Scudetto.
Two years ago he went to take the goalkeeper in Scotland, after which until 2003 had trained those of Catania.
